The Study On The Insertion Angle Of Miniscrews At The Infrazygomatic Crest

Objective:In this study,we measured the bone width at the implant site below the infrazygomatic crest and the three-dimensional insertion angle of a miniscrew in the infrazygomatic crest.This study was conducted to provide a more reliable guide for clinicians to select a suitable direction for miniscrew placement in the infrazygomatic crest.Materials and Methods:Our sample consisted of CT images from 9 women and 9 men aged from 19 to 30 years.Helical CT images were examined,and the CT data was imported into the Mimics10.01 software.The three-dimensional models were reconstructed in the software.Select the interested section at the infrazygomatic crest and then measured as follows:Part 1:measured the bone width at the implant site between the cortical bone surface and the first molar roots from 2 to 8mm below the alveolar crest at 2 mm intervals;Part 2:meassured the routine insertion angles to the sagittal plane and horizontal plane respectively when the miniscrew with the 6mm effective lenghth was inserted at 4mm,6mm,8mm level from the alveolar crest at the mesiobuccal root of the maxillary first molar.All data analyses were carried out using SAS 9.1 to measure the means and standard deviation。Results:Part 1:The bone width at 2mm,4mm,6mm,8mm level from the alveolar crest at the mesiobuccal root was2.34±0.57mm,2.37±0.47mm,2.51±0.46mm,2.68±0.54mm respectively;at the middle point of two buccal roots was2.64±0.57mm,2.76±0.42mm, 2.66±0.40mm,2.88±0.67mm respectively;at the distobuccal root was.2.81±0.60mm, 2.92±0.51mm,2.72±0.50mm,2.84±0.68mm respectively;The bone width was greater at the higher level from the alveolar crest.The bone width at the distobuccal root was greater than the mesiobuccal root and the middle point at the 2mm,4mm and 6mm level from the alveolar crest.Part 2:The insertion angle to the sagittal plane and to the horizontal plane was 17.9±9.6°,23.8±16.4°respectively,and the the angle rang to the sagittal plane and to the horizontal plane was 12.8±7.9°,38.5±22.1°respectively when the implant site was at the 4mm from the alveolar crest at the mesiobuccal root of the maxillary first molar;the angle to the sagittal plane and to the horizontal plane was 24.7±10.5°,26.7±15.2°respectively,and the angle rang to the sagittal plane and to the horizontal plane was 9.5±7.5°,42.2±11.9°respectively when the implant site was at the 6mm level;the angle to the the sagittal plane and to the horizontal plane was 18±11.5°,13.8±11.8°respectively,and the angle rang to the sagittal plane and to the horizontal plane was 11.0±6.8°,37.4±17.0°respectively when the implant site was at the 8mm level.The angle either to the sagittal plane or the horizontal plane was biggest at the 6mm level from the alveolar crest.Conclusion:Part 1:The implant site was possible at 4mm,6mm,8mm level from the alveolar crest at the mesiobuccal root and the middle position between the two buccal roots of the maxillary first molar.Part 2:1.The insertion angles and the angle rangs were different when the implant site was at different level from the alveolar crest at the mesiobuccal root of the maxillary first molar. 2.The insertion angle is variable with individual variation,the angle was suitable for some people.It was necessary to assess the bone volume and insertion angle before miniscrew implant.
